Flam may refer to:

*Flam, a percussion rudiment
*Flåm, a town in Norway

People with the surname Flam:

*Harry Flam (born 1948), Swedish economics professor at Stockholm University
*Herbert Flam (1928-1980), Jewish-American tennis player
*Leopold Flam (1912-1995), Belgian philosopher
*Abraham Bär Flahm - the editor and publisher of the Dubner Maggid
